Applicable Shares definition

Applicable Shares means (i) the total number of issued and outstanding Company Shares transferred to Purchaser under Clause 3.1(d) of the Plan of Arrangement, including the Company Shares issued to holders of Company RSUs under Clause 3.1(c) of the Plan of Arrangement, plus (ii) the total number of Dissent Shares transferred to Purchaser under Clause 3.1(a) of the Plan of Arrangement.
Applicable Shares means, as of each Valuation Date, the sum of (i) all issued and outstanding shares of New Common Stock on such Valuation Date (including, for the avoidance of doubt, any shares of New Common Stock issued in connection with a CVR Share Distribution) plus (ii) the aggregate number of shares of New Common Stock issuable by the Company assuming all outstanding and in-the-money warrants and options (whether vested or unvested) and any other security convertible into or exerciseable or exchangeable for shares of New Common Stock (other than CVRs and shares of New Common Stock distributable in respect thereof) were converted, exercised or exchanged, as applicable, in full on such Valuation Date by paying the strike prices (if any) of such warrants, options and other securities in cash.
Applicable Shares means all Shares that are Beneficially Owned by the Shareholder or that become Beneficially Owned by the Shareholder prior to the Termination Date.

More Definitions of Applicable Shares

Applicable Shares means the number of Purchased Shares issued to Investor at all previous Closing under this Agreement plus such additional number of Purchased Shares otherwise issuable at the Third Closing or the Fourth Closing, as the case may be, when added to the number issued at previous Closings, as would equal the Applicable Limit. For avoidance of doubt, Applicable Shares does not include the Warrant or the Warrant Shares issued or issuable upon exercise thereof.

Applicable Shares means the same class of shares (Common Stock or Class B Stock, as the case may be) to which the Rights were originally attached, except that if such Rights were originally attached to shares of Class B Stock which are subsequently converted into Common Stock, Applicable Shares in respect of such Rights shall be shares of Common Stock.
